Birpur Population - Muzaffarpur, Bihar
Birpur is a medium size village located in Saraiya Block of Muzaffarpur district, Bihar with total 119 families residing. The Birpur village has population of 607 of which 322 are males while 285 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Birp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 119 which makes up 19.60 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Birpur village is 885 which is lower than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Birpur as per census is 776, lower than Bihar average of 935.
Birpur village has higher liter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Birpur village was 77.05 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Birpur Male literacy stands at 87.84 % while female literacy rate was 65.24 %.

Birpur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 119 | - | - |
Population | 607 | 322 | 285 |
Child (0-6) | 119 | 67 | 52 |
Schedule Caste | 129 | 67 | 62 |
Schedule Tribe |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Literacy | 77.05 % | 87.84 % | 65.24 % |
Total Workers | 185 | 151 | 34 |
Main Worker | 156 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 29 | 9 | 20 |
